Transaction 317191e9a646f780630dee992def794ec031c49e95d8ce3ffdfcea9b571e3f23

1 Input
2 Outputs
  • 317191e9a646f780630dee992def794ec031c49e95d8ce3ffdfcea9b571e3f23:0
  • value  335302184
    address  1Q4Tv5xrTfdt7GkcM6iLHh75w9Hmrp59nV
  • 317191e9a646f780630dee992def794ec031c49e95d8ce3ffdfcea9b571e3f23:1
  • value  19791
    address  18ZFc2EyBmrtAoquo7c9jTC1nvf4UMmhBP